Robert Girard (April 12, 1948 – November 5, 2017) was a Canadian ice hockey player who played 305 National Hockey League (NHL) games with the California Golden Seals, Cleveland Barons and Washington Capitals. He scored 45 goals and 69 assists in his NHL career. He also played for the Charlotte Checkers, Salt Lake Golden Eagles and Hershey Bears in the minor leagues.[1]

He died in L'Épiphanie, Quebec on November 5, 2017 at age 69.[2]
